IL5RA and TNFRSF6B gene variants are associated with sporadic IgA nephropathy.

Familial clustering and genome-wide linkage scans strongly support a genetic susceptibility to familial IgA nephropathy (IgAN), but genetic factors that predispose to sporadic IgAN are unknown.
